|
|
@@ -359,8 +359,8 @@ public class OrderTask extends AbstractTask {
|
|
|
String code = "YS" + product.getMaterialCode();
|
|
|
int id = jdbcTemplate.getInt("SELECT PRODUCT_SEQ.NEXTVAL FROM DUAL");
|
|
|
//生成物料资料
|
|
|
- String insertProductSql = "INSERT INTO PRODUCT(PR_ID,PR_CODE,PR_DETAIL,PR_SPEC,PR_UNIT,PR_ORISPECCODE,PR_BRAND,pr_remark_sale,pr_manutype,PR_PURCHASEPOLICY,PR_SUPPLYTYPE,PR_ZXBZS,PR_ZXDHL,PR_ACCEPTMETHOD,"
|
|
|
- + "PR_RECORDMAN,PR_DOCDATE,PR_AUDITMAN,PR_AUDITDATE,PR_STATUS,PR_STATUSCODE) VALUES(?,?,?,?,?,?,?,?,'外购','MRP','推式',?,?,'不检验','ADMIN',SYSDATE,'ADMIN',SYSDATE,'已审核','AUDITED')";
|
|
|
+ String insertProductSql = "INSERT INTO PRODUCT(PR_ID,PR_CODE,PR_DETAIL,PR_SPEC,PR_UNIT,PR_ORISPECCODE,PR_BRAND,pr_remark_sale,pr_manutype,pr_dhzc,PR_SUPPLYTYPE,PR_ZXBZS,PR_ZXDHL,PR_ACCEPTMETHOD,"
|
|
|
+ + "PR_RECORDMAN,PR_DOCDATE,PR_AUDITMAN,PR_AUDITDATE,PR_STATUS,PR_STATUSCODE) VALUES(?,?,?,?,?,?,?,?,'PURCHASE','MRP','PUSH',?,?,'不检验','ADMIN',SYSDATE,'ADMIN',SYSDATE,'已审核','AUDITED')";
|
|
|
jdbcTemplate.execute(insertProductSql, id, code, product.getModel(), product.getSpec(), product.getUnit(), product.getModel(), product.getBrand(),product.getInvoiceModel() , product.getMpq(), product.getMoq());
|
|
|
//生成供应商物料对照关系
|
|
|
jdbcTemplate.execute("insert into productVendor(pv_id,pv_prodid,pv_detno,pv_vendid,pv_vendcode,pv_vendprodcode,pv_vendprodspec,pv_vendprodunit,pv_vendname,pv_prodcode,pv_zxbzs) "
|